Cirkut (camera)
The Cirkut is a rotating panoramic camera, of the type known as "full rotation". It was patented by William J. Johnston in 1904, and was manufactured by Rochester Panoramic Camera Company starting in 1905; during that same year, the company was acquired by the Century Camera Co. (which itself was owned by Eastman Kodak at the time). Manufacture of the camera continued through 1949.
